python创建表格pandas
时间: 2023-10-19 18:36:18 浏览: 66
要使用Python的Pandas库创建表格,你可以按照以下步骤进行操作:
1. 首先,确保已经安装了Pandas库。可以使用以下命令安装:
```python
pip install pandas
```
2. 导入Pandas库:
```python
import pandas as pd
```
3. 创建一个空的DataFrame对象,并指定列名和数据类型(可选):
```python
df = pd.DataFrame(columns=['列名1', '列名2', ...], dtype='数据类型')
```
例如,创建一个具有两列('Name'和'Age')的空表格:
```python
df = pd.DataFrame(columns=['Name', 'Age'])
```
4. 若要添加数据行到表格中,可以使用`loc`属性指定行索引,并为每一列赋值:
```python
df.loc[0] = ['John', 25]
df.loc[1] = ['Alice', 30]
```
5. 可以使用`head()`方法来查看表格的前几行数据:
```python
print(df.head())
```
这样就可以创建一个简单的表格并添加数据。你还可以通过Pandas提供的丰富功能来处理和操作表格数据。
相关问题
python创建表格
你可以使用Python的pandas库来创建表格。以下是一个简单的示例代码:
```python
import pandas as pd
# 创建一个字典来表示表格的数据
data = {'姓名': ['张三', '李四', '王五'], '年龄': [20, 25, 30], '性别': ['男', '女', '男']}
# 使用pandas的DataFrame函数来创建表格
df = pd.DataFrame(data)
# 打印表格
print(df)
```
这段代码将会输出以下表格:
```
姓名 年龄 性别
0 张三 20 男
1 李四 25 女
2 王五 30 男
```
你可以根据自己的需求修改数据和表格的格式。
python创建表格并合并表格
在Python中,可以使用pandas库来创建和合并表格。下面是一个示例代码:
```python
import pandas as pd
# 创建第一个表格
df1 = pd.DataFrame({'A': [1, 2, 3], 'B': [4, 5, 6], 'C': [7, 8, 9]})
# 创建第二个表格
df2 = pd.DataFrame({'A': [10, 11, 12], 'B': [13, 14, 15], 'C': [16, 17, 18]})
# 合并两个表格
df3 = pd.concat([df1, df2])
# 输出合并后的表格
print(df3)
```
在上面的代码中,我们首先使用pandas库创建了两个表格df1和df2。然后,我们使用pandas的concat函数将这两个表格合并成一个新的表格df3,并将其打印出来。
除了concat函数,pandas库还提供了其他函数来合并表格,如merge函数和join函数。这些函数的使用方法和参数略有不同,可以根据具体需求来选择合适的函数。